Rommel Duran

General Manager, Ecuador at Phoenix Tower International

Rommel Duran is the current General Manager for Phoenix Tower International in Ecuador. Prior to this, they served as the Country Manager for Torresec from July 2013 to April 2020. In this role, they were responsible for developing relationships with clients, managing over 400 telecommunication assets, and leading a team of contractors to keep projects on schedule and within budget. Rommel also has experience teaching at Pontificia Universidad Católica del Ecuador and UNIVERSIDAD DE LAS AMERICAS ECUADOR. Rommel began their career in 2008 as a Telecommunications Technician for Secretaría de Ambiente MDMQ before moving on to Telefónica, where they served as the Head of Site Acquisition from 2010 to 2013.

Rommel Duran has a Master of Science in Information Technology from Carnegie Mellon University, a Master's degree in Administración de Tecnologías de Información from Tecnológico de Monterrey, and a Master's degree in Comunicaciones Ópticas y Tecnologías Fotónicas from Politecnico di Torino. Rommel is also an engineer in Electrónica y Telecomunicaciones from Universidad de las Fuerzas Armadas - ESPE.
